Nummus 322-323 AD
Roman Empire
Metal: Bronze.
Issuing entity: Rome. Constantine I.
Mint: Rome.
Date: 322-323 AD
Obverse:
Laureate bust right bearing shield and eagle-like sceptre in right hand. Legend: CONSTAN-TINVS AVG.
Reverse:
Globe on altar with inscription VOT/IS/XX. Above three stars. Legend: BEATA TRAN-QUILITAS. Mint mark: -PTR-. Of. 1ª.
Weight: 3.17 g - Diameter: 19 mm - Axes: 2 h.
Described in: RIC VII 369.
